应用故障定位:系统问题排查的实用技巧
在信息化时代,系统故障已经成为企业运营中不可避免的问题。快速、准确地定位故障原因,对确保企业业务的连续性和稳定性至关重要。本文将为您介绍一些实用的系统问题排查技巧,帮助您高效地进行故障定位。
一、了解系统架构
在排查系统故障之前,首先要了解系统的整体架构。这包括系统的硬件、软件、网络等组成部分,以及它们之间的关系。了解系统架构有助于您快速定位故障发生的位置。
硬件设备:检查服务器、网络设备、存储设备等硬件设备的运行状态,确保它们正常工作。
软件系统:了解操作系统、数据库、中间件等软件系统的版本、配置和依赖关系。
网络环境:检查网络连接、带宽、路由器、防火墙等网络设备的配置和性能。
二、收集故障信息
在发现系统故障后,及时收集相关故障信息是排查故障的关键。以下是一些常用的故障信息收集方法:
日志分析:通过分析系统日志,了解故障发生前后的系统状态,找出异常信息。
客户端反馈:与用户沟通,了解故障发生时的具体表现和现象。
监控数据:查看系统监控数据,如CPU、内存、磁盘、网络等指标,判断是否存在性能瓶颈。
系统配置:检查系统配置文件,确保各项配置符合要求。
三、定位故障原因
在收集到足够的信息后,可以开始分析故障原因。以下是一些常见的故障原因:
软件故障:包括操作系统、数据库、中间件等软件系统的bug、配置错误或依赖问题。
硬件故障:服务器、网络设备、存储设备等硬件设备出现故障。
网络故障:网络连接不稳定、带宽不足、路由器故障等。
系统负载:系统资源使用率过高,导致性能下降。
外部因素:如自然灾害、电力故障等。
四、解决故障
在定位到故障原因后,采取相应的措施解决问题。以下是一些常见的故障解决方法:
软件故障:修复或更新软件版本,调整配置参数。
硬件故障:更换或修复故障硬件设备。
网络故障:检查网络设备配置,优化网络连接。
系统负载:优化系统配置,提高资源利用率。
外部因素:采取应急措施,如备用电源、网络切换等。
五、总结与预防
在解决故障后,对故障原因进行分析和总结,以便在以后避免类似问题发生。以下是一些预防措施:
定期进行系统维护和检查,确保硬件设备正常运行。
对软件系统进行定期更新和升级,修复已知bug。
加强网络安全防护,防止网络攻击。
制定应急预案,提高应对突发事件的能力。
加强团队协作,提高故障排查和解决效率。
总之,掌握系统问题排查的实用技巧,有助于提高故障定位和解决能力,确保企业业务的稳定运行。在实际操作中,根据具体情况灵活运用各种技巧,才能在故障发生时迅速应对。
猜你喜欢:Prometheus